Step 4: Expand-phase migration for Lattivo's billing schema. Apply the additive columns first, deploy dual-write code, then backfill in batches of 10k rows. Do not drop legacy columns until the verify job reports parity for 24 hours. Keep the old read path behind the flag until sign-off from the data team. Before cutting over reads, confirm the migration runner uses the exact settings below.

settings of bahop-kaweg:
[novael]
host = novael.braskstack.example
user = novael_svc
database = novael_prod

Hi Priya,

Welcome to on-call for the Skylark plugin platform. A note for the external plugin authors you'll support: request tracing spans our Corvid microservices end to end, and plugins must propagate the trace header or their calls vanish from the timeline. When an author reports a "lost" request, first check whether their plugin strips headers on retry — that's the cause nine times out of ten. The header format, sampling rules, and debugging walkthrough are all on the internal page below.

operations page: https://confluence.norvacorp.corp/spaces/dash/dash/a5a4e1c207d6

Ticket: Printer-spooler microservice wedges after queue drain. The Inkrell spooler stops accepting new jobs once its queue empties while a cancel request is in flight; the worker thread exits but the health check still passes, so nothing restarts it. On-call: symptom is jobs stuck in PENDING with no errors. Restarting the pod clears it. Suspected race in the shutdown handler introduced in the latest rollout. Until the patch lands, watch the queue-depth dashboard. The affected build token is recorded just below.

session token of tajef-bageg = htk21_5d90d574934f3ccae6437